The circumstances of Ka-Ess' death remain unknown but are widely believed to be horrific. Contemporary sources invariably omit the actual cause of death, instead couching the event in epithet and euphemism. Some scholars speculate that this suggests a sacreligious, unutterable, or indescribable death, a theory in keeping with the Fishwives' documented interest in [[Old Gods]]. | The circumstances of Ka-Ess' death remain unknown but are widely believed to be horrific.
